Galvanized gutter installation involves attaching durable metal gutters made from galvanized steel to the edges of a property’s roof. These gutters are designed to effectively channel rainwater away from the foundation, siding, and landscaping. The installation process typically includes measuring the roofline, selecting appropriate gutter lengths, and securing the gutters with brackets to ensure they stay in place during heavy rain or wind. This service helps protect the structural integrity of a home by managing water runoff and preventing water from seeping into walls or pooling around the foundation.

One common problem galvanized gutter installation helps solve is water overflow during storms or heavy rainfall. Without proper gutters, water can spill over the roof edges, leading to erosion, basement flooding, or damage to exterior walls. Additionally, gutters help prevent the buildup of standing water that can attract pests or cause mold growth. Installing galvanized gutters provides a long-lasting solution that withstands the elements, reducing the need for frequent repairs or replacements and maintaining the property's exterior appearance.

The overview below groups typical Galvanized Gutter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Edmond, OK.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Minor gutter repairs or replacements typically cost between $150 and $400. Many routine fixes fall within this range, depending on the extent of damage and materials needed.

Partial Replacement - Replacing sections of gutters usually ranges from $500 to $1,200 for most homes. Larger projects or homes with complex rooflines may push costs higher but remain less common.

Full Gutter System Installation - Installing a complete gutter system generally costs between $2,000 and $4,500. Most homeowners in Edmond find their projects fall within this range, with larger or custom setups reaching $5,000+ in some cases.

Complex or Large-Scale Projects - Extensive gutter work, such as multiple-story homes or custom designs, can exceed $5,000. These projects are less frequent but handled by local contractors for larger or more intricate installations.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of galvanized gutters? Galvanized gutters are durable, resistant to rust, and require minimal maintenance, making them a reliable choice for protecting a property’s foundation and landscaping.

How do galvanized gutters compare to other gutter materials? Galvanized gutters typically offer a longer lifespan and better resistance to corrosion compared to aluminum or vinyl options, providing lasting performance in various weather conditions.

What should I consider when choosing a galvanized gutter installation service? It’s important to select experienced local contractors who can assess your property’s specific needs and ensure proper installation for optimal performance.

Are there different styles or sizes of galvanized gutters available? Yes, galvanized gutters come in various profiles and sizes to accommodate different roof types and drainage requirements, which local service providers can help determine.

What is involved in the process of installing galvanized gutters? Installation typically includes measuring, fitting, and securing the gutters to ensure effective water flow and proper attachment to your building’s fascia.
